Royal Gardens is in Leeds and in Leeds district. LS10 2RR is located in the Hunslet & Riverside elect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Leeds Central.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. The area surrounding LS10 2RR has a slightly higher male population, with 51.1% of residents being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).

Health

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.

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.

This area has a lower perc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(68.8%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either an older population or social deprivation in the area.

Education and Qualifications

During the 2021 census, the educational qualifications of residents across the UK were as follows: 18.2% had no qualifications, 9.6% had 1-4 GCSEs, 13.4% had 5 or more GCSEs and 1-2 A/AS Levels, 16.9% had 2 or more A Levels, 33.8% held a degree (or equivalent), and 5.4% had completed an apprenticeship.

In the area around LS10 2RR this area, 40.8% of residents have no qualifications. This is significantly higher than the UK average of 18.2%. This area stands out for its low percentage of residents with higher education degree. The UK average is 33.8%, while in this area it is 13.6%.

Safety

Is Royal Gardens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Royal Gardens was 202.5 per 1,000 residents, which is 50.5% lower than the Hunslet & Riverside average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Royal Gardens has the 71st highest crime rate of 168 local areas in Hunslet & Riverside and the 429th highest crime rate of 2,525 local areas in Leeds .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 105.5 crimes per 1,000 residents and have remained broadly unchanged year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-68.6%.
